Southwest Turkey Burgers W/ Easy Guacamole
Ready In: 30 mins
Serves: 4
Yields: 4 burgers
Ingredients
Burgers
- 1 lb ground turkey breast
- 1 green bell pepper (chopped)
- 1 white onion (chopped)
- 1 egg
- 1 (2 ounce) package taco seasoning
- 4 slices monterey jack pepper cheese
- 4 whole grain buns
Guacamole
- 3 -4 avocados (mashed)
- 2 tablespoons garlic salt
- 2 roma tomatoes (diced)
- 8 -10 black olives (sliced)
- 3 tablespoons feta cheese (crumbled)
- 1⁄2 lemon, juice of
Directions
- Spray a medium saucepan with cooking spray and sautee bell peppers and onions until tender. Set aside.
- Using your hands, combine ground turkey, egg, taco seasoning, peppers and onions in a mixing bowl.
- Form into four patties and grill until cooked all the way through. You may also choose to cook in a deep skillet on the stove, if desired. When nearly cooked, place a slice of pepperjack cheese on top to melt.
- While burgers are cooking, prepare guacamole.
- Combine all guacamole ingredients in a medium mixing bowl.
- Serve burgers on buns and topped with a heaping scoop of guacamole. Make sure to have tortilla chips on hand for any left over guac!
